A plaque on the sundial's base describes the work:
"This sundial sculpture created by Henry Moore and commissioned by the Trustees of the B. F. Ferguson Monument Fund is erected in recognition of the revolutionary program of space exploration which was launched in the second half of the twentieth century, making it possible for man to land on the moon and to send probes to Mercury, Venus, Mars, Jupiter, and Saturn.
-May 1980"
The sundial sits outside the Adler Planetarium overlooking downtown Chicago with a gorgeous view of the skyscrapers standing behind the shores of Lake Michigan.
Sundial Type: Equatorial - plate in plane of equator
